Ignore Lunardi/Palm.
http://www.bracketmatrix.com/
A winner in any given year might be a fluke, which is why the Matrix averages and ranks bracketologists by their last five seasons. The results are fascinating: Alongside mainstream writers such as The Athletic's own Stewart Mandel (No. 2) are lesser-known folks like Wollangk (No. 5) or SyracuseFan7 (No. 3), whose projections have consistently topped the matrix average. The most prominent bracket experts, Lunardi and Palm, rank 40th and 82nd, respectively.
In 2016, an entrant named Delphi Bracketology won the top spot. The most accurate projections were the product of a group of students at Delphi (Ind.) Community High School, part of the school's Bracketology Club. The kids met at their teacher's house and Buffalo Wild Wings to pore over their picks. They were featured in a televised CBS segment. They also hung a banner — “National Bracket Champions, 2016” — in the Delphi gym.
The reigning holder of Phan's award, however fake it may be, is a 47-year-old resident of Madison, Ind., named Dave Ommen. In real life, Ommen is a marketing and public relations pro at the local hospital. In the world of bracket projections, Ommen is BracketDave, the highest-rated bracketologist in the Matrix's five-year average rankings and the only person to finish two seasons ranked No. 1.
